Document Description
AMEND EXISTING DEVELOPMENT PLAN FOR MARINA BAY PROJ WHICH WAS APPROVED BY CITY IN 1984. PROPOSED CHANGES INVOLVE REARRANGING THE PROJECT'S INTERNAL CHANGES WILL NOT AFFECT EITHER THE NUMBER OF RESIDENTIAL UNITS OR THE TOTAL AMOUNT OF COMMERCIAL DEVELOPMENT. REVISED SKETCH PLAN USING PRIOR EI
